Q: Is 235,407,351 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 235,407,351 is a composite number.

Why is 235,407,351 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 235,407,351 can be evenly divided by 1 3 78,469,117 and 235,407,351, with no remainder.

Since 235,407,351 cannot be divided by just 1 and 235,407,351, it is a composite number.
